Renault India is all set to reveal the new Renault Bridger concept SUV tomorrow i.e, March 10, 2026. The Bridger will be the brand’s new sub-4-metre SUV, expected to be positioned alongside the Kiger. The name ‘Bridger’ is derived from the word ‘bridge’, with the letters ‘ER’ added for identification, and the SUV will be designed and developed in India. The company also said that the name is intended to symbolise connection, reflecting the brand’s idea of linking innovation, design and markets through its upcoming compact SUV.

Renault Bridger

As per the teasers, the Renault Bridger concept’s design reveals a boxy silhouette and a tailgate-mounted spare wheel. Renault has confirmed that the upcoming urban SUV will measure under 4 metres in length but will not compromise on cabin space. A teaser video also shows illuminated Renault lettering on the fascia, similar to the international-spec Renault Duster. Other exterior highlights include upright stance, a squared silhouette, a high bonnet line and flat body surfaces inspired by traditional off-road vehicles. At rear, it also features the tailgate-mounted spare wheel, commonly seen on off-road-focused SUVs.

The new Bridger, internally codenamed RB3-K2 B-SUV, is expected to be offered with multiple powertrain options, including petrol, hybrid, CNG and electric. It’s also expected to use the 1.0-litre turbo-petrol engine from the Renault Kiger. The unit produces 100hp and is available with a manual or CVT transmission.Once introduced, the model is expected to compete with rivals such as the Maruti Suzuki Fronx, Hyundai Venue, Mahindra XUV 3XO, Tata Nexon and Kia Sonet in the segment. The model will also benefit from Renault’s localisation strategy and positioning in the Indian market. A version from Nissan is also likely to follow at a later stage. For Renault, the model could help strengthen its sales in India by expanding its presence in the high-volume compact SUV segment, where demand remains strong.
